Command Line

Hopki also provides command-line tools. Use them when you need repeatable batch processing or want to run the same operation outside the GUI.

hopki-gui

Launches the desktop app.

uv run hopki-gui
uv run hopki-gui path/to/experiment

If a directory is supplied, Hopki opens it as the initial experiment.

wft-to-csv

Converts Nicolet .WFT oscilloscope captures into legacy .FLT text files.

uv run wft-to-csv input.WFT output.FLT

Use --help for batch options such as output directories.

twobar-analyze

Runs the core analysis pipeline on an experiment directory and writes MATLAB-style output vectors.

uv run twobar-analyze EXP_DIR \
  --tim-cut 2.83e-5 \
  --reflect-shift 3 \
  --nu 0.29 \
  --invert \
  --out OUT_DIR
Option Meaning
EXP_DIR Experiment directory.
--tim-cut Required pulse-start time in seconds.
--reflect-shift Reflected-pulse shift in samples. Default: 0.
--nu Poisson ratio for dispersion correction. Default: 0.29.
--invert Negates input signals before analysis.
--out Output directory. Defaults to the experiment directory.

figcorr

Runs curve cleanup operations from the command line.

uv run figcorr CURVE --cut 256 --zero

Use uv run figcorr --help for the full operation list.
